WebEmbedded 4" into a 6" min. concrete beam or 8" nominal grouted block wall. For mislocated truss anchors which are greater than 1/8" but less than 1 1/2" from the face of the truss, a shim must be provided. Shim design by truss engineer. When gap is greater than 1 1/2", abandon existing embedded truss anchor and install new anchor per designer. WebLoads on Roof Trusses: 1. Dead Loads: These consist of weights of trusses, roof coverings, purlins and bracings. Usually the dead load on the truss is expressed as the load per unit … WebRoof live load greater than 20 psf (0.96 kN/m 2) and ... WebMar 28, 2024 · Putting the Truss Together. 1. Measure and mark your timber with a pencil. Before you begin sawing your raw materials, lay out your lumber on a flat surface and trace a line where you plan on making each cut. Precise measurements are critical if you want your truss to be sturdy and fit together properly.

WebDec 28, 2024 · Span: Up to 14 meters. Fink trusses are the most common truss seen in residential roof construction. The webbing in fink trusses has a ‘W’ shape, giving them a great load-carrying capacity.
